Officials at jails in both counties deny the allegations. A private company, Armor Correctional Health Services, has contracts to provide medical care to the two facilities.
The company also denies the charges, but acknowledges that in some cases medication is delayed because inmates have refused treatment or won't cooperate.
Last week in California the family of an HIV-positive transsexual awaiting deportation filed a wrongful death suit against the federal government alleging she was denied medication.
